However, I do support my FLGS for peripherals like paints, brushes, GS, assorted tools, etc. It's a decent gesture that says "thanks for still being here" and it also satisfies my The treads fit quite well actually, the only modification you have to make (key words- "have to") are cutting out the tabs on the track wells on the vehicle that are designed to keep the stock tracks in place. Another bonus is that you'll invariably have extra bits left over becasue there's no reason why you have to go all the way up and around as the top of the tracks are covered by the body of the vehicle (this is true for the Rhino, Land Raider, and Super Heavies). For customization of Chaos vehicles I don't think there's anything better, and if I didn't use the MK1 Rhino bodies I'd have them all using Machinator's tracks as well. I had to dig into them right away, and since enough people asked what I was going to do w/ them and how I was going to do it, here's a short WIP / Tut on how I'm doing my Raptors.

BASES-

Very important. I'm going with as dynamic and "action-orientated" poses as I can, which means the center of balance is likely going to be compromised on a lot of my new models. To manage that issue I weight my bases w/ nickles:



It adds a decent amount of weight and has worked very well for me in the past. VERY IMPORTANT- DO NOT glue the nickles in all at once! See below for reasons why.

POSING AND PINNING-

I'm going for a "about to land" look which requires a lot more work than just gluing a model that has one foot slightly raised off the base. Here's how I'm making that happen:









Drill out hole in foot and in base, pin the two together, glue the nickel to the base, glue the miniature to the pin. Easy.

The next Raptor I worked on of course had to be the opposite of course. Because of what I had to use as a pin (16 gauge wire) I found it easier to glue first, then pin:

The pin, model, and base:



Pin bent to shape:



Model drilled to insert pin:



Nickel glue and hole drilled. Pin was flattened on end that was connecting to base to it connected like a tab:



Pinned model form two angles"

It's not just Typhus that gets that. A Chaos Lord with the Mark of Nurgle, Khorne or Slaanesh unlocks Plague Marines, Berserkers or Noise Marines as troops respectively. The Sorcerer with Mark of Tzeentch unlocks Thousand Sounds.

A Primary Detachment is your 'main' army. Secondary detachments etc. are when you take extra Force Org charts or Allies.
